About the course

The demand for clean energy specialists is rapidly increasing, with a focus on the production, storage, and transmission of renewable energy sources and transition fuels. This course equips students with essential mechanical and electrical engineering principles, alongside expertise in sustainable technologies such as solar, wind, geothermal, tidal systems, hydrogen, power storage, and distribution. As the World Meteorological Organization predicts, clean energy supply must double by 2030 to meet net-zero goals, potentially creating 42 million renewable jobs globally. Students also develop commercial skills in planning, project management, and innovation to stay abreast of industry advancements.Key attractions include £27,000 scholarships, teaching by chartered engineers with industry collaboration, access to state-of-the-art labs, optional industry placements, and free maths support. Graduates can pursue roles in energy engineering, designing power plants, reducing carbon emissions, conducting site inspections, and optimizing energy efficiency to minimize environmental impact.
